Call for Applications for 2013 CeReNeM/hcmf// Scholarship

We are pleased to offer the CeReNeM/hcmf// Scholarship for PhD studies in Composition commencing in September 2013.

  • one 100% fee waiver with £5000 annual stipend for Full-Time study, 3 years
  • competitive scholarship open to new Home/EU and International PhD students
  • Supervision from internationally renowned staff
  • Mentoring from Graham McKenzie, Artistic Director of the Huddersfield Contemporary Music Festival
  • Opportunities for performance, publication, teaching experience
  • Candidate is required to be resident in Huddersfield for the duration of the scholarship

To Apply: see online Application form.

Include Research proposal with statement of how you might connect to the opportunity of working with CeReNeM and Huddersfield Contemporary Music Festival. Application should be accompanied by a folio of work: articles or other written work, scores (if relevant), audio and/or visual recordings. Folios can also be sent electronically to the contacts below.

Closing date: 1 March 2013 (postmark date)
